Role Overview:
We are seeking a dynamic and strategic leaders to manage a large-scale operations team of 150+ professionals across key functions including Controllers, Middle Office, and Client Services. This role spans all strategies within BlackRock private markets, requiring a seasoned leader with deep operational expertise, cross-functional collaboration skills, ability to connect local leadership and process to global functional alignment, and a strong commitment to talent development and organizational excellence.
Key Responsibilities:
Operational Leadership
Oversee daily operations across Controllers, Middle Office, and Client Services functions.
Ensure accurate and timely deliverables through monitoring and engagement
Drive operational excellence and process optimization across the team.
Strategic Initiatives
Lead and execute cross-functional initiatives that align with broader business goals.
Collaborate with senior stakeholders across investment, finance, technology, and compliance teams as well as global and regional leadership.
Serve as a key escalation point for complex operational issues and client concerns.
Talent Management
Build and nurture a high-performing team culture focused on accountability, innovation, and continuous improvement.
Lead workforce planning, recruitment, and succession strategies.
Champion learning and development programs to upskill talent and foster career growth.
Client & Stakeholder Engagement
Act as a senior representative for stakeholder interactions, ensuring exceptional service delivery and relationship management.
Partner with internal stakeholders to resolve escalations and drive client satisfaction.
Governance & Risk Oversight
Maintain strong controls and governance frameworks to mitigate operational risk.
Ensure compliance with regulatory requirements and internal policies.
Qualifications:
Proven experience (18+ years) leading large teams, private markets experience preferred
Deep understanding of operational processes and organizational management
Strong strategic thinking and execution capabilities
Exceptional communication, stakeholder management, and problem-solving skills.
Demonstrated success in leading cross-functional initiatives and change management.
Bachelor’s degree required; advanced degree or professional certification (e.g., CFA, CAIA) preferred
